Explain the rule for multiplying two negative integers. Use a number line or algebra tiles to illustrate three examples. Make a sketch of your work.

Multiplying two negative numbers would always give you a positive product

Example 1) -2 * -1 = 2

Example 2) -5 * -4 = 20

Example 3) -10 * -3 = 30
